1991 Citroen AX vs. 1974 DAF 66

To start off, 1991 Citroen AX is newer by 17 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1974 DAF 66.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1974 DAF 66 would be higher. At 1,108 cc (4 cylinders), 1974 DAF 66 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1991 Citroen AX (48 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 3 more horse power than 1974 DAF 66. (45 HP @ 5000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1991 Citroen AX should accelerate faster than 1974 DAF 66.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1974 DAF 66 weights approximately 160 kg more than 1991 Citroen AX.

Because 1974 DAF 66 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1974 DAF 66.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1991 Citroen AX,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, both vehicles can yield 75 Nm of torque. So under normal driving conditions, the ability to climb up hills and pull heavy equipment should be relatively similar for both vehicles.

Compare all specifications:

1991 Citroen AX 1974 DAF 66
Make Citroen DAF
Model AX 66
Year Released 1991 1974
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 953 cc 1108 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 48 HP 45 HP
Engine RPM 6000 RPM 5000 RPM
Torque 75 Nm 75 Nm
Torque RPM 3700 RPM 2700 RPM
Engine Bore Size 70 mm 70 mm
Engine Stroke Size 62 mm 72 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 9.4:1 8.5:1
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Front Rear
Number of Doors 3 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 668 kg 828 kg
Vehicle Length 3510 mm 3870 mm
Vehicle Width 1560 mm 1540 mm
Vehicle Height 1360 mm 1390 mm
Wheelbase Size 2290 mm 2270 mm
